I used Demand End Use Components Summary for LEED Documentation (according energyplus documentation), but in a recent project, the reviewer team has send me a observation about this issue, because the Demand End Uses Components Summary Plots demand in peak time for each energy source. (not by end uses separatedly). this situation becomes particularly unpleasant when,by example,  a project uses electricity for heating and cooling and then the peak time is only showed for heating time or only cooling time (wichever is greater).
For address this issue i use the Output Table: Summary Reports: PeakEnergyEndUseElectricityPart1Monthly, PeakEnergyEndUseElectricityPart2Monthly, PeakEnergyEndUseNaturalGasMonthly, PeakEnergyEndUseDieselMonthly, etc.
